Traditional Cataract Surgical Treatment Benefits And Drawbacks
When taking into consideration standard cataract surgery, you may find that it's a well-established and widely-used method. In this procedure, a specialist makes a small cut in the eye and utilizes ultrasound to break up the over cast lens prior to removing it. Once the cataract is eliminated, a fabricated lens is placed to recover clear vision.
Among the primary benefits of traditional cataract surgical treatment is its track record of success. Many people have actually had their vision significantly improved through this procedure. Furthermore, typical surgery is commonly covered by insurance policy, making it a much more available choice for lots of people.
Nevertheless, there are some disadvantages to conventional cataract surgery also. Laser-Assisted Techniques Benefits And Drawbacks
Exploring laser-assisted methods for cataract surgical treatment reveals a contemporary approach that utilizes laser technology to perform crucial action in the procedure. One of the primary advantages of laser-assisted cataract surgical treatment is its accuracy. The laser allows for very accurate cuts, which can result in far better aesthetic end results. Additionally, the use of lasers can decrease the quantity of ultrasound power required throughout the surgical procedure, potentially lowering the threat of problems such as corneal damages.
On the disadvantage, laser-assisted methods can be a lot more expensive compared to standard approaches. This cost mightn't be covered by insurance, making it much less available to some clients.
One more consideration is that not all cataract cosmetic surgeons are learnt laser modern technology, which could limit your options for choosing a specialist.
Finally, while the laser can automate certain elements of the treatment, the surgery still calls for a proficient cosmetic surgeon to make certain successful outcomes.
Relative Evaluation of Both Methods
For a comprehensive understanding of cataract surgery techniques, it's necessary to perform a comparative analysis of both traditional and laser-assisted techniques.
Traditional cataract surgical treatment entails hands-on lacerations and making use of portable tools to break up and eliminate the cloudy lens.
On the other hand, laser-assisted cataract surgery utilizes advanced modern technology to develop exact incisions and separate the cataract with laser energy prior to removing it.
In regards to precision, laser-assisted methods provide a greater level of precision compared to typical techniques. The use of lasers allows for modification of the procedure based upon each individual's eye composition, possibly bring about much better visual end results.
However, laser-assisted cataract surgical treatment often tends to be much more costly than typical surgery, which might limit ease of access for some patients.
While both methods work in bring back vision impaired by cataracts, the selection between conventional and laser-assisted strategies frequently depends upon variables such as cost, accuracy, and specific person demands.
Consulting with your eye doctor can aid establish the most suitable technique for your cataract surgical treatment.
